Houston Rockets
The Houston Rockets have been in poor form as they've lost eight of their last 12 games overall and they will be hoping for a better performance after getting routed by the Timberwolves in a 111-90 road defeat on Sunday. Alperen Sengun led the team with 15 points and 10 rebounds, Cam Whitmore added 14 points off the bench while Fred VanVleet chipped in with 11 points. As a team, the Rockets shot just 35 percent from the field as they played great defense to hold the Timberwolves to just 17 points in the second quarter to stay within striking distance at halftime, only to get blown out by 63-46 in the second half to lose big in the end. Jalen Green had a rough night as he scored just eight points on three of 15 shooting from the field and zero of five from the 3-point line.
Indiana Pacers
Meanwhile, the Indiana Pacers were struggling for a bit there as they were riding a three-game losing streak before they snapped out of it with a 115-99 road win over the lowly Hornets on Sunday. Pascal Siakam led the team with 25 points, eight rebounds and nine assists, Aaron Nesmith added 22 points with eight rebounds and four assists while Tyrese Haliburton chipped in with 17 points in just 20 minutes before leaving the game with a hamstring strain. As a team, the Pacers shot 48 percent from the field and 11 of 33 from the 3-point line, but they set up this win with their defense as they were always in control after restricting the Hornets to just 13 points in the first quarter. The Pacers will meet the Warriors and Knicks after this one.
Indiana Pacers Player Facts
- Aaron Nesmith ranks 2nd amongst qualified players for 3P% (46.3%) this season.
- Myles Turner ranks 10th amongst qualified players for Blocks Per Game (1.8) this season.
Houston Rockets Player Facts
- Alperen Sengun ranks 3rd amongst qualified Centers for assists per game (5.1) this season.
- Jabari Smith Jr. ranks 25th amongst qualified players for rebounds per game (8.3) this season.
Matchup/League Facts
- The Pacers rank 1st in the league for points per game this season (124.2).
- The Pacers rank 1st in the league for assists per game this season (30.8).
- The Rockets rank 2nd in the league for opponent free throw percentage this season (74.9%).
- The Rockets rank 29th in the league for opponent free throw attempts per game this season (26.4).
